Output 26d3e4b80e9751bf37daa1420a4a128a2d763a83b82b2072f96005a097b77e6b:5

value
40662009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36aa3406678736f9ee3c2e8d3928fbcb09c8efca OP_EQUAL
address
MCtCciVn8HmNEbN67PjPzgTRcTvVK9pFdT
transaction
26d3e4b80e9751bf37daa1420a4a128a2d763a83b82b2072f96005a097b77e6b
spent
true